Town
Sauðárkrókur is a town on the in northern . It is the seat of both the and the . Sauðárkrókur is the largest town in Northwest Iceland and the second-largest town on the north coast of Iceland, with a population of 2,612. is situated 2½ km southeast of Skarð.
